Overview

The climate in Lander can be described as continental with distinct seasons. The weather here ranges from freezing winters to warm and sunny summers, making the city an interesting destination for those who enjoy diverse natural conditions. Overall, the climate is quite dry, but travelers should be prepared for significant temperature contrasts.

Winter in the region is cold and bracing: in January and February, nighttime temperatures can drop below -11°C, creating a true winter atmosphere. Summer, by contrast, brings pleasant warmth. The hottest months are July and August, when daytime temperatures warm up to a comfortable +27...+28°C, which is ideal for outdoor activities and walks.

Spring and autumn serve as transitional periods with changeable weather. Special attention should be paid to May, which stands out for having the highest number of days with precipitation, although its intensity is usually low. September often delights with a mild "Indian summer" before a significant cooling occurs in October and November.

Temperature

The climate in Lander is characterized by pronounced seasonality and a significant annual temperature range. The coldest period here is traditionally the winter months, especially January and February, when average nighttime temperatures drop to -11.7°C. Conversely, the peak of warmth occurs in mid-summer: July is considered the hottest month, welcoming travelers with daytime maximums of around 28.7°C.

Summer in this region can be described as warm and comfortable, ideal for outdoor activities. From June to August, daytime temperatures often rise to 24-28°C, creating pleasant conditions for walking. However, tourists should be prepared for sharp daily fluctuations: even after a hot July day, the nights bring a noticeable freshness and chill when the air cools down to 12°C. This difference between day and night figures is a characteristic feature of the local climate.

The winter season in Lander is frosty and quite harsh. From December to February, sub-zero temperatures prevail, and even during the day, the thermometer rarely rises above freezing. Spring arrives gradually: although the air already warms up to 10°C during the day in April, night frosts can persist until May, requiring travelers to have warm clothing at any time of year except the height of summer.

Precipitation

In Lander, the nature of precipitation depends directly on the changing seasons and temperature fluctuations. In winter, when the thermometer drops significantly below freezing, precipitation falls exclusively as snow. The coldest months—December, January, and February—bring a moderate number of snowy days (averaging 5 to 7 per month), creating a typical winter atmosphere without excessive blizzards.

The wettest period occurs in late spring and early summer. May stands out as the rainiest month of the year: statistics show about 14 days with precipitation and the highest volume of moisture compared to other seasons. June and July also remain quite wet, with frequent rains (10–11 rainy days), so an umbrella or raincoat will not be out of place in a traveler's luggage at this time of year.

By the beginning of autumn, the weather stabilizes, and September becomes one of the driest months of the year along with January—with only about 5 days of precipitation. Gradually, by November, the rain gives way to snow again, closing the city's annual climate cycle.

Packing Tips

When planning a trip to Lander (USA), the main principle for packing your suitcase should be layering. The climate here is characterized by significant temperature swings, so even in summer, when daytime temperatures reach a comfortable 20–28°C, nights can be cool (around 12°C). Be sure to bring light T-shirts for daytime walks, but don't forget to pack a fleece, a thick hoodie, or a windbreaker to stay cozy after sunset.

If your trip falls during the winter months, prepare for real cold: temperatures often drop below freezing, averaging -5°C to -11°C. You will need high-quality thermal underwear, a warm down jacket, a hat, a scarf, and gloves. Spring and autumn here are quite chilly, so a mid-season jacket and windproof clothing will be very useful. Given that the number of days with precipitation increases in May and June, it is worth bringing a compact umbrella or a light raincoat, although heavy downpours are rare here.

Regardless of the season, you will need comfortable, broken-in flat shoes to explore the city and its surroundings. For winter, choose insulated boots with non-slip soles, and for summer, breathable sneakers. Since Lander is in a region with quite active sun, be sure to bring sunglasses and SPF cream, even if it is cool outside.
